Why pilgrims come
A sacred place worth the journey.
A Franciscan mountain shrine above the Soča and Nova Gorica, rebuilt after wartime destruction and reached by road or a steep pilgrim path with Stations of the Cross. Its strength is living Marian pilgrimage and Franciscan custody, not an unsupported apparition claim.
